Lightbulb Active Autowerke N55 Performance Flashes Available Soon, Dyno chart inside...



Hello Fellow 1 Addict Members,

We would like to introduce our newest N55 Performance Flash for the 2011+ 135. The N55's true potential has been hindered from factory, through careful remapping to the DME tables our Engineers have re-engineered the ECU/Engine combination to work in unison to produce an increase of approximately 40 RWHP and 51 Ft. Lbs. of Torque on our Mustang Dyno (Gains on dynojet will be higher), more power is available depending on your supporting modifications. Our engineering team also has the ability to provide off-road upgrades for cars with downpipes/no cats as well as top speed limiter removal. For any enthusiast looking to maximize their N55's ability to perform at the next level on an everyday basis this ugprade is a must.

Key Features:
  • No Piggyback Needed
  • Factory ECU Flash
  • 17% Horsepower gain over stock yielding 358 BHP
  • 22% Torque gain over stock yielding 373 Ft-Lbs. of Torque
  • Increase of 51 Ft. Lbs. of Torque at the Wheels (Mustang Dyno)
  • Increase of 40 RWHP (Mustang Dyno)
  • Off Road Setup Available for cars w/ Downpipe Upgrade
  • Top Speed Limiter Removal available for Off-Road Setup
  • Completely Reversible
  • Non Detectible
  • Remapping of A/F, WOT, Part Throttle Maps, Ignition Maps

Quote:
Originally Posted by alexc93 View Post
Overpriced in my opinion.... giac's previous tunes are much cheaper, along with ess. What is the differences for the cost if i was to go with you active autowerke?
Both GIAC & ESS only have tunes for the N54 Motor. This Tune is for the N55 Motor, this Software flash is done through the factory ECU and provides a stealth setup without using a piggyback system. PM directly and I will be more than glad to give you Special Intro Pricing.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Groundzero View Post
Does this flash have any other modes? My A3 flash came with a 91, 93, and 100 octane program plus a security lockout. Is this the same sort of thing?
Yes, we currently have a tune for Downpipes and for 91 & 93 Octane. We are currently testing latest prototype tune with methanol injection and will have the results posted once we received the information from our Engineering Department.
